Swirls marks on a brand new car, you know….the ones with less than 10 miles, are caused by the detailers! Most car dealerships have the lowest paid people to wash and dry their cars. I have witnessed the use of cotton rags to dry new cars before being delivered to the customer. Anyone with the simplest knowledge of how not to scratch new clear coat would always employ the proper car care. Clean sponges, microfiber towels etc. Visit an upscale car dealership! |
